Monroe 58639 Load Adjust Shock Absorbers are precision-engineered rear shocks designed for 2000-2006 Chevrolet Suburban, Tahoe, and GMC Yukon models. Featuring a 1200 lbs load capacity, adaptive valving for consistent handling, and advanced all-weather fluid technology, these shocks reduce sag under load and improve ride quality. Built with durable nitrocarburized rods and self-lubricating seals, they offer extended service life and OEM-level fitment for a seamless upgrade that professionals trust.

So far this has been a really great purchase! I came here after Detroit Axles shocks fell apart after only a week and me sounding like crunchy knee caps even going over the smallest bump. Wish Monroe had the front coils like this but I’ll be getting those elsewhere. I could feel the difference right after install they adjust to weight automatically and dont mess with the oem ride height. Just install and go. They are sturdy like the oem A/C Delcos heavy duty towing shocks. Im kinda sad I paid $127 for them to drop 40 bucks the next day but whatevs. Buy them! 2004 GMC Yukon SLT 5.3 V8 4x4

This is my second set purchased, both for older model Yukons- amazing results, highly recommended. On the second Yukon, switched air suspension to these and the ride/stability is superb.

Amazing difference! Replaced for 2004 GMC Yukon XL with ZW7 smooth ride suspension and non electric non Z55 autoleveling Novamat shocks. Added about an 1 inches in the rear but it looks better that way. Much cheaper that the Novamat shocks and rides firm and smooth.
